Ultimately, the parent has a right to refuse any medical intervention or treatment for their child, including a vaccine. Their decision, however, may conflict with a pediatricians advice.
All states allow exemptions for medical reasons, and almost all states (except California, Mississippi and West Virginia) grant religious or philosophical exemptions for people who have sincerely held beliefs that prohibit immunizations.
Hib is NOT required once a student turns 5 years of age. Pneumococcal conjugate is NOT required once a student turns 5 years of age. Influenza is NOT required once a student turns 5 years of age. HepA requirement for school year 20242025 applies to all Pre-K through 12th graders born 1/1/07 or later.
California removed its personal and religious exemption option in 2015. Parent/guradian must complete an online educational module to receive a non-medical exemption. Connecticut removed its religious exemption option in 2021.
Connecticut removed its religious exemption option in 2021. If a religious exemption was granted prior to April 28, 2021, the exemption will be honored through 12th grade. D.C. A personal exemption is allowed for the HPV (human papillomarvirus) vaccine only.
